A Scots mum whose daughter was tragically stillborn is desperate to save the charity who helped her through the darkest time of her life.Charlie Gallagher, from Castlemilk, went into labour at 33-weeks and found out her daughter did not have a heartbeat when she was rushed to hospital.The 34-year-old was admitted to an ICU maternity room as her condition rapidly deteriorated and she turned seriously unwell.
Sadly, on October 15, 2018, doctors told Charlie that her daughter Jessica was stillborn and she was lucky to have survived.
After the heartbreaking loss of her daughter, Charlie and her partner received crucial support from Dalkeith based charity SiMBA.
She is now desperate to save the organisation from closure due to spiralling costs and a significant shortfall in fundraising, Glasgow Live reports.
